NVIDIA Corporation Description

NVIDIA Corporation, a visual computing company, develops graphics chips for use in personal computers (PC), mobile devices, and supercomputers. The company operates through two segments, GPU and Tegra Processors. The GPU segment offers GeForce for consumer desktop and notebook PCs; Quadro for professional workstations; Tesla for supercomputing servers and workstations; GRID Graphics Modules for industry-standard servers to accelerate virtual desktop infrastructure; and GRID Systems for applications ranging from streaming games to hosting graphics-intensive design applications. The Tegra Processors segment offers Tegra processor, a system-on-a-chip that provides visual and multimedia experience on tablets, smartphones, and gaming devices; Icera baseband processors and radio frequency transceivers for mobile connectivity; integrated chip solutions, which combine the Tegra applications processor and the Icera baseband processor; Project SHIELD, an Android gaming device that help users enjoy digital content in the cloud; Tegra VCM, a Tegra-based vehicle computing module, which integrates an entire automotive computer into a single component; and embedded computing platforms for various digital consumer devices, such as TVs and smart monitors. The company sells its products to original equipment manufacturers, original design manufacturers, system builders, add-in card and motherboard manufacturers, and consumer electronics companies, as well as gamers, enterprises, and tablet and mobile phone users. NVIDIA Corporation was founded in 1993 and is headquartered in Santa Clara, California.
